Transaction 766691b751a8f5b2f68183145d98d65fa0ea97c1ac50b991e78c7663c1acd423
1 Input
1 Output
- 
    
      766691b751a8f5b2f68183145d98d65fa0ea97c1ac50b991e78c7663c1acd423:0
    
    - value
- 112036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bec0c869eadfec76abbfa5a0f10330fc80604d8 OP_EQUAL
- address
- 3MjrgXDPTUDnw7R68JRWs9dzioF7R1KT7A